Mistress Raven heads a staff of 14 at Pandora's Box, a 4000-square-foot, high-class Manhattan sex club that bills itself as the "Disneyland of Domination." Interspersed with pages made of latex, rubber, colored gels, and other erotic materials, Magnum photographer Susan Meiselas's documentary photographs of the club's highly formalised rules and rituals, its role-playing "vacations from reality," reveal both the customers who frequent the club and the women who command them. First commissioned to accompany the Nick Broomfield documentary Fetishes, Meiselas's Pandora's Box is a darkly captivating journey into a high-class sex club that specializes in sado-masochism. On the outskirts of the five boroughs sits Coney Island, the world famous pleasure beach that has been the summer destination for New Yorkers since its heyday in the 1890s. Toward the end of the 1960s, just one year after he first picked a camera, Bruce Gilden took the subway train through Brooklyn to capture the sunbathers, the weekenders, and the sideshow freaks who stroll the Boardwalk and sprawl on the sands of Coney Island. As the area's reputation slipped, Gilden continued to take pictures. The result is this book, which gathers together a selection of his Coney Island photographs from the late 1960s up through the late 1980s, some of which are paired with handwritten recollections, all of which testify to Gilden's ability to eke out the characters and eccentricities of daily life. Hardcover. Photographically illustrated paper covered boards, no dust jacket as issued, contained in a printed black and white slipcase. Photographs by Susan Meiselas / Magnum. Essays by Mistress Raven, Richard August and Mistress Delilah. Designed and produced by Browns, London. Printed by Butler and Tanner. 92 pp., with 64 four-color illustrations. Some of the pages bound into the book are made of the following latex, rubber, mylar-like materials: Text Arctic the Extreme 150gsm; Caliper 1mm natural rubber grade 'S.'; Lee colour filter mirror silver 271; Caliper 350-micron natural rubber grade 'S'; Polyurethane-coated polyester interlock; Lee colour filter bright pink 128; and Lee colour filter flame red 164. 8 x 12 inches. Produced as a promotional piece to highlight the capabilities of Munken Lynx paper, this book was only distributed to designers and members of the printing industry and was never available for sale to the general public. The fifty intensely saturated images of flowers were shot by Parr around the world. "Over the years, I've built up a sequence of flower photos; it's one of those subjects that all photographers are tempted to try.".
